For years, the crypto industry has shouted about bridging traditional finance and decentralized ledgers. Binance’s move is the loudest echo yet: allow non-crypto-native traders to speculate on equities with crypto-native mechanics—no expiration date, high leverage, and a funding rate that keeps the synthetic price tethered to the real one. Yet the underlying infrastructure is profoundly centralized. These are not tokenized stocks held on-chain; they are cash-settled derivatives managed by Binance’s order book and liquidation engine. The user never owns the underlying asset. They hold a contract that mimics price action, governed by a single entity’s risk parameters.
The core insight lies in the oracle dependency. Every funding period, every liquidation, every price movement of these perpetuals relies on an accurate and timely price feed for PYPL, GS, and the ETFs. Binance likely uses Pyth Network or an internal solution, but the data source remains external and permissioned. Binance’s stock perpetuals face a similar, albeit less extreme, risk: if the oracle lags during volatile market hours—say, when GS drops 5% in after-hours trading due to an earnings miss—the perpetual price could deviate, causing cascading liquidations. The 20x leverage magnifies this exponentially. From my experience leading code audits on DeFi liquidity pools, I can attest that even a 0.5% deviation in price feed can trigger massive cascades when leverage is high. While Binance’s perpetual system is battle-tested for crypto assets, applying it to equities introduces new complexities. For instance, stock exchanges have trading halts; crypto perpetuals never sleep. How will Binance handle a halt in PYPL trading? Will they freeze the contract, or let it trade based on a last price that is stale? The documentation is silent. The contrarian angle is uncomfortable but necessary. Most market commentary will frame this as a bullish signal for crypto adoption—a bridge between worlds. I argue the opposite. This is a regressive step that re-packages a banned product (CFDs for retail investors in the US, UK, and several EU jurisdictions) inside a crypto wrapper. The SEC and CFTC have already established that perp contracts on single stocks can be securities derivatives. Binance’s ongoing settlement with the SEC complicates matters. Launching this product feels like a deliberate test of the settlement’s boundaries. Trust is not given; it is computed and verified. If regulators decide to enforce, the product will be shut down, and Binance may face additional penalties. The risk is not just to Binance—it sets a precedent that could chill innovation by associating perpetuals with regulatory arbitrage. They have not clarified whether non-US users only will have access, or if they will try to geo-block American IPs. But geo-blocking is trivial to bypass, and regulators often consider intent. The ETF component is especially tricky. An ETF is itself a basket of securities; a perpetual on an ETF is a derivative on a derivative. The legal stacking creates extra layers of potential illegality.
